881308-68-5,881308-70-9,477587-42-1,496878-61-6,886570-56-5,305335-77-7 Supplier | ORGCHEMSHOP.COM
CMO CDMO service. ORGCHEMSHOP.COM supply 881308-68-5,881308-70-9,477587-42-1,496878-61-6,886570-56-5,305335-77-7 and related compounds.
881308-70-9 881308-68-5 496878-61-6 477587-42-1 305335-77-7 886570-56-5